Know how to cure bad breath? How about we start with the basics. Good oral hygiene is essential to cure bad breath. How often do you brush your teeth? Dentists agree that brushing at least two minutes is essential. This is a routine you should practice two or three times a day. Don't forget to scrap tongue either. This is one of the quintessential ways to cure bad breath. All that bacteria that hangs out on your taste buds must be knocked down with your favorite toothpaste.

Another vital step for making bad breath only a memory is to floss. We all have to resort to the filament if we really want to rid our teeth and gums of plaque and tarter build-up that can lead to gingivitis and dragon breath. Flossing daily is a prerequisite.

Then there is the old reliable mouthwash. This is one of the most preferred ways to cure bad breath, and it's certainly one of the easiest. A daily swishing of the teeth and gums is the consummate way to obliterate bacteria and germs that can cause bad breath. What mint-flavored mouthwash is hiding in your medicine cabinet? And it doesn't have to scorch your mouth in order to work well either.

Besides good oral cleanliness, there are a number of other ways to cure bad breath. Take a stroll down the candy isle at any local store. You'll find refreshing chewing gums to sparkling mints galore. Plus you'll have no problem finding some more modern ways to cure bad breath. Be aware of the sugar content though. Make sure to buy reduced sugar or sugar free items to cure bad breath. You want to preserve those pearly whites and prevent cavities. While no one wants sour breath, they do likely prefer a set of healthy choppers.

If what we've talked about isn't leading to a fresher mouth and you aren't winning the fight against the malodorous mouth, then you might need to consult an expert to learn more.
